Output 6399f4b4ab05c7eb9443200115b076630ce7de47344bd87d3085ad3ef56e1517:6

value
530217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d62da098c294c265a8424679aae46b23c711344 OP_EQUAL
address
34NPwShdqvAQZ69yudcRGYee1HiWhkS933
transaction
6399f4b4ab05c7eb9443200115b076630ce7de47344bd87d3085ad3ef56e1517
spent
true